Young people at Little Parndon showcase graffiti work
Young people at Little Parndon scheme in Harlow took part in a graffiti art project last month, working with a professional artist to produce a wonderful array of artwork. The project saw residents at the young people's supported housing scheme in Essex learn the basic techniques used in graffiti from professional artist, Scott Irving (left), before producing their own work which is now on display at the scheme.
The tenants were full of ideas and Scott showed them how best to develop their initial designs, expand them and introduce other concepts into the work.
Two residents, who are also art students, were thrilled to get feedback from Scott on their portfolios, whilst they all had the chance to develop skills and an interest in a new activity.
As well as creating their own work, they all worked together to produce a joint picture.
